Quantitation of Basophil-Bound IgE in Atopic and Nonatopic Subjects

Abstract
Basophil-bound IgE was measured by quantitative immunofluorescence microscopy in atopic subjects and in healthy controls. A correlation was found between IgE serum level and basophil-bound IgE. The basophils from the atopic patients, both from those with a low and those with an increased serum IgE, showed a significantly higher fluorescence intensity than the basophils from the respective controls. Our results indicate that both atopy and the IgE level of the serum determine the amount of basophil-bound IgE.
